IMF slaps Pakistan with 11 more conditions! $7 billion bailout on line
The International Monetary Fund has imposed 11 new conditions on Pakistan's $7 billion bailout program, bringing the total to 64 over 18 months. These directives target governance and corruption, requiring asset declarations from high-level civil servants by December next year and an action plan to combat corruption in 10 departments by October next year.

Lululemon CEO Calvin McDonald to step down in January as sales continue to drop
Lululemon CEO Calvin McDonald is stepping down January 31 amid a challenging sales year, with the board seeking a successor. The athletic wear brand reported a 2% net revenue decline in the Americas and a 13% profit fall in its third quarter, facing increased competition and market shifts. Shares rose over 10% following the announcement.

IndiGo crisis: DGCA sacks 4 flight operations inspectors for oversight; airline asked to hire more pilots
The DGCA has dismissed four inspectors overseeing IndiGo after the airline failed to hire enough pilots for upcoming flight duty time limits, leading to disruptions and a temporary rollback of rules. Despite DGCA warnings, IndiGo denies shortages. Sources cite deep mistrust between pilots and management, worsened by pay changes, policies, and attempts to restrict pilots from taking jobs abroad.
